I have always planned my SCA schedule over three different time spans. The first is Gulf Wars to roughly Pennsic. Gulf Wars typically marks the beginning of the equestrian activities for the year and historically, the end of July (or Pennsic) marks the middle of the season for it. The next is of course is from that point to roughly the end of October, which for my two kingdoms is pretty much the end of the equestrian activities. And the one coming up is the winter from roughly November to Gulf Wars.
